Park Fire

Park fires, also known as wildfires, are a significant natural hazard that can have devastating effects on the environment, wildlife, and human communities. These fires occur in wildland areas and can spread rapidly, fueled by dry vegetation, high temperatures, and strong winds. While some park fires are caused by natural factors such as lightning strikes, many are the result of human activities, including campfires, discarded cigarettes, and arson.

One of the key factors contributing to the intensity and spread of park fires is climate change. Rising global temperatures have led to longer and more severe fire seasons, as well as drier conditions that make forests and grasslands more susceptible to ignition. In recent years, major park fires have been reported worldwide, from the wildfires in California and Australia to those in the Amazon rainforest and Siberia.

The impact of park fires on the environment can be profound. They can destroy vast areas of forest, leading to loss of habitat for wildlife and disruption of ecosystems. The intense heat generated by wildfires can sterilize the soil, making it difficult for vegetation to regrow. Additionally, the smoke and ash produced by these fires can have far-reaching effects on air quality, affecting human health and contributing to climate change.

Wildlife is particularly vulnerable during park fires. Many animals are unable to escape the fast-moving flames, resulting in significant mortality rates. Those that do survive often face challenges such as loss of habitat and food sources, increased competition, and exposure to predators. Recovery for wildlife populations can take years, and some species may struggle to rebound if their habitats are severely damaged.

Human communities located near wildland areas are also at risk during park fires. Homes, infrastructure, and livelihoods can be destroyed in a matter of minutes, leading to displacement and economic hardship. Firefighters and emergency responders work tirelessly to contain and extinguish these fires, but their efforts are often hampered by the difficult terrain and unpredictable fire behavior.

Efforts to prevent and manage park fires are critical to mitigating their impact. This includes implementing strict fire regulations, promoting public awareness and education, and investing in fire management infrastructure. Controlled burns, also known as prescribed fires, are used to reduce the buildup of flammable vegetation and create firebreaks that can help contain wildfires. Advances in technology, such as satellite monitoring and fire prediction models, also play a crucial role in early detection and response.

In conclusion, park fires are a complex and challenging natural hazard that requires a coordinated approach to prevention, management, and recovery. As climate change continues to exacerbate fire conditions, it is essential for governments, communities, and individuals to work together to protect our natural landscapes and reduce the risk of catastrophic wildfires.
